Senior Generative AI Software Engineer jobs in United States
cer-icon
Apply on Employer Site
company-logo

NVIDIA · 3 hours ago

Senior Generative AI Software Engineer

NVIDIA is a leading company in AI technology, and they are looking for a Senior Generative AI Software Engineer to join their Cosmos generative AI engineering team. The role involves owning and evolving codebases, integrating models, and ensuring code quality and maintainability in the context of generative modeling and AI computing.

Artificial Intelligence (AI)Consumer ElectronicsGPUHardwareSoftwareVirtual Reality
check
Growth Opportunities
check
H1B Sponsor Likelynote

Responsibilities

You will own and evolve the Cosmos open-source and internal research codebases, crafting core infrastructure that supports our foundation model research and deployment
Refactor and modularize large research-driven code into clean, testable, maintainable libraries for use across teams
Integrate and adapt off-the-shelf models into our pipelines as preprocessors, postprocessors, or evaluation components
Build model-serving endpoints (e.g., with Gradio or FastAPI) to enable researchers and internal users to experiment with models interactively
Design, implement, and maintain evaluation pipelines, providing high-quality tooling to the broader team to measure model quality and track improvements
Improve configuration hygiene and reproducibility using systems like Hydra, and ensure smooth overrides, templates, and environment switching
Lead efforts in packaging and release of Python modules using modern tools (uv, just, pydantic) for both OSS and internal consumption
Set the standard for code health, test coverage, and release readiness across the team. Write documentation and automation to scale good practices

Qualification

PythonPyTorchGenerative modelingHydraPython packaging toolsCode healthModel servingMentoring

Required

Expert-level proficiency in Python, with a strong foundation in modular design, abstraction boundaries, and collaborative codebase evolution
Fluency with PyTorch, including the ability to run, debug, and patch inference-time model behavior in research-level codebases. Comfort modifying pre/post-processors, model wrappers, and checkpoint logic
Proven experience in refactoring large codebases—cleaning up legacy implementations, eliminating anti-patterns, and paying down tech debt to improve long-term maintainability
Strong grasp of configuration systems, especially Hydra, with an emphasis on reproducibility, override logic, and environment scoping
Familiarity with Python packaging tools like uv, just, and pydantic, including experience managing environment consistency and shipping libraries as artifacts
Strong instincts around code health: API design, directory structure, writing unit and integration tests, exception hygiene, docstrings, and dependency isolation
Comfortable deploying models internally via Gradio or similar frameworks to enable interactive evaluation and feedback from researchers or downstream users
BS or MS (or equivalent experience) in Computer Science, Software Engineering, or a related technical field and 10+ years of industry experience

Preferred

Proficiency in model configs, especially Hydra! Comfortable crafting hierarchical config systems with reusable templates, environment scoping, and overrides for evaluation, inference, or release
Prior work cleaning up sophisticated generative model codebases—adding tests, improving wrappers, and instrumenting code for observability and debugging
Demonstrated success raising engineering quality in a research setting: taking exploratory code and evolving it into a robust, production-friendly module
Track record of mentoring teammates on software engineering best practices and proactively identifying long-term structural risks in fast-moving teams
Passion for building ML tooling that is not only functional, but also elegant, intuitive, and maintainable by others

Benefits

Equity
Benefits

Company

NVIDIA is a computing platform company operating at the intersection of graphics, HPC, and AI.

H1B Sponsorship

NVIDIA has a track record of offering H1B sponsorships. Please note that this does not guarantee sponsorship for this specific role. Below presents additional info for your reference. (Data Powered by US Department of Labor)
Distribution of Different Job Fields Receiving Sponsorship
Represents job field similar to this job
Trends of Total Sponsorships
2025 (1877)
2024 (1355)
2023 (976)
2022 (835)
2021 (601)
2020 (529)

Funding

Current Stage
Public Company
Total Funding
$4.09B
Key Investors
ARPA-EARK Investment ManagementSoftBank Vision Fund
2023-05-09Grant· $5M
2022-08-09Post Ipo Equity· $65M
2021-02-18Post Ipo Equity

Leadership Team

leader-logo
Jensen Huang
Founder and CEO
linkedin
leader-logo
Michael Kagan
Chief Technology Officer
linkedin
Company data provided by crunchbase